Anne Craig, Margaret Chambers, Elizabeth Clarage, and I met with Will Cross last Friday to discuss the possibility of his presenting an Open Pedagogy program for CARLI members and the PDA. Through those discussions he recommended a two-part series to be presented during Open Education Week as well as the week after. Below are just preliminary notes about the programs; we will share more details as we receive them.
Open Pedagogy Series with Will Cross:
March 8 at 2:00 p.m. CST / 3:00 p.m. EST, a foundational session on Open Pedagogy (audience is mainly librarians)
March 15 at 2:00 p.m. CST / 3:00 p.m. EST, an outreach and advocacy, connecting with faculty session (audience is librarians, invitation to bring in teams: instructional designers, faculty, etc.)
